Step 4: Tune GC pauses in the Pairline matcher. If your plugin sees match callbacks arriving late, it's almost always the matcher's garbage collector stalling under load — bump the heap target in `matcher.toml` before blaming your own code. We've seen pauses drop from 400ms to under 20ms just by doing that. Once the heap settings look sane, restart the Pairline daemon so it picks up the new env file. The daemon also needs its broker credential to reconnect, so add that line now.

env line for kaweg-hawip: LEDGER_TOKEN13=119f0d8c76b81

Runbook: contrast audit for Lumenfall dashboard. Run the Tintcheck sweep against all themes before Thursday sync. Flag any pair under 4.5:1; dark-mode sidebar is a known offender. Fixes go through the Palette Board, no ad-hoc hex edits. Maria owns triage this week. Results already landed in the shared tracker. The sweep that produced them is identified below.

session token of bawep-yadup = htk21_528abd376e3c5a4ec24a1

## Deploying the Gatewick Proctor Queue

Deploys are pretty painless: push to main, wait for the pipeline, then watch the queue drain dashboard for five minutes. If candidates pile up mid-exam, roll back first and ask questions later — the queue replays safely. Everything the workers care about lives in one config block, shown here for reference.

settings of bafof-yagef:
JOROX_PIN=8740
JOROX_TENANT=pelox
JOROX_METRICS_HOST=metrics.jorox.qorvelworks.internal
JOROX_SEAL=seal_c78f63c1
JOROX_STANDBY_TEAM=norax